    Palantir Technologies: Decoding the Data Giant

    Now, let's shift our focus to Palantir Technologies. This is a company that often finds itself at the center of discussions about technology, government, and privacy. Palantir is, at its core, a data analytics company. But it's not just any data analytics company. Palantir specializes in helping organizations – particularly government agencies and large corporations – make sense of massive and complex datasets.

    Here’s what you need to know about Palantir:

    1. Founding and Mission: Palantir was founded in 2003 by Peter Thiel, among others. Its initial mission was to develop software that could help government agencies track and combat terrorist activities. This background has significantly shaped the company's identity and its relationship with government clients.
    2. Key Products: Palantir is known for two primary software platforms: Palantir Gotham and Palantir Foundry. Gotham is designed for government and law enforcement agencies, helping them analyze data related to national security, counterterrorism, and law enforcement. Foundry, on the other hand, is geared toward commercial clients, enabling them to integrate and analyze data from various sources to improve business operations and decision-making.
    3. Controversies and Ethical Concerns: Palantir has faced its fair share of controversies. Critics have raised concerns about the company's work with government agencies, particularly regarding privacy and civil liberties. The ability to analyze vast amounts of data raises questions about potential surveillance and the potential for misuse of information. There are also debates about the ethical implications of using Palantir's technology in areas such as predictive policing.

    Fox News: Shaping the Narrative

    Let's turn our attention to Fox News. As one of the most influential cable news channels in the United States, Fox News plays a significant role in shaping public opinion and political discourse. Understanding its role is crucial to grasping the dynamics at play when we talk about something like IIITRump.

    Here are some key aspects of Fox News to consider:

    1. Audience and Reach: Fox News has a substantial and dedicated audience, particularly among conservative viewers. Its reach extends beyond television through its website, social media channels, and radio broadcasts. This extensive reach gives Fox News considerable power to influence public perception and set the agenda for political discussions.
    2. Political Stance: Fox News is generally considered to have a conservative or right-leaning political bias. This bias is reflected in its news coverage, commentary, and the perspectives of its hosts and guests. While the network maintains that it strives for objectivity, critics often point to instances where its coverage appears to favor Republican politicians and conservative viewpoints.
    3. Influence on Political Discourse: Fox News has a significant impact on the way political issues are framed and discussed in the United States. It can shape the narrative around key events, influence the public's understanding of policy debates, and play a role in shaping the outcome of elections. Its influence extends to other media outlets, as its coverage often sets the tone for discussions on other news channels and in print publications.
